Transaction 601101ec59a3a673400348f32bc5f35e5ab510c360551a4f6f4dd50f8ff05427
1 Input
1 Output
-
601101ec59a3a673400348f32bc5f35e5ab510c360551a4f6f4dd50f8ff05427:0
- value
- 19906836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44a3fbf69b02f6a3d88f5cbaeabb22f0ad12bf56 OP_EQUAL
- address
- 37wxKQsWrJpk4RpzTNxoe7KFnQvvvNX1xT